Re: [milter-greylist] Reject instead of deferring for local sendmail

2014-11-26 by Georgi Petrov

Well, here is the same with racl blacklist:

milter-greylist: ratelimit overflow for class outgoing_mail_limit: 13, limit is 3 recipients / 300 sec, key = "user@..."
milter-greylist: 4534E1E2D7E: addr localhost[127.0.0.1] from user@... to otheruser@... blacklisted (ACL 157)
postfix/cleanup[3021]: 4534E1E2D7E: milter-reject: RCPT from localhost[127.0.0.1]: 5.7.1 Message quota exceeded; from=<user@...> to=<otheruser@...>
postfix/cleanup[3021]: warning: 4534E1E2D7E: milter configuration error: can't reject recipient in non-smtpd(8) submission
postfix/cleanup[3021]: warning: 4534E1E2D7E: deferring delivery of this message

The message is deferred and not rejected again, also the messages stay in the queue forever (if we use greylist the messages are sent when the user drops under the limit).

Georgi

On Wed, Nov 26, 2014 at 12:27 PM, Emmanuel Dreyfus manu@... [milter-greylist] <milter-greylist@yahoogroups.com> wrote:

On Wed, Nov 26, 2014 at 12:15:47PM +0200, Georgi Petrov georgi.petrov@... [milter-greylist] wrote:
> Is there a way we can reject or drop instead of deferring any message over
> the queue even for non smtpd submission (when sent through PHP mail or
> local sendmail)?

Why don't you use racl blacklist for rate limit?
